The BAMS course-Bachelor of Ayurvedic Medical and surgery which is a 5.5 years course in which Admissions taken on the basis of enterance exam of NEET-UG Examination and minimum eligibility criteria is passed 10+2 qualification with 50-60% aggregate and with subjects like Physics, chemistry and Biology.

The average fee structure is range from INR 20,000 to INR 2,00,000/-
